Obituary of Eugenia Lebron-Conde

Bonaire, Georgia – Eugenia Lebron-Conde, 85, passed away peacefully on Tuesday, October 5, 2021 at Atrium Health Navicent Health. A visitation with family and friends will be held on Saturday, October 9, 2021 from 12:00PM – 2:00PM at Heritage Memorial Funeral Home.

 

Eugenia was born on December 30, 1935 in Patillas, Puerto Rico to the late Jesusa Conde and Francisco Lebron. Eugenia was a very simple woman who loved her family very much and strived to provide for those she loved and cherished. She was a very quiet woman but was full of wisdom that she often times shared with her beloved family.  Eugenia had a true love for animals and the joy they had brought to her. She will forever be remembered as a devoted family member who loved being surrounded by those she cherished and sharing a smile.

 

In addition to her parents, her beloved husband, Hector Velazquez and her brother, Julio Lebron, precede Eugenia in death.

 

Left to cherish her memory is her beloved children, Pedro (Norma) Rodriguez, Lucy (Benjie) Reyes, William (Debbie) Montes, Manuela Montes, Carmen Montes, Domingo Montes, and Gernardo (Rosa) Montes. She is also survived by 13 grandchildren, 28 great-grandchildren, and many extended family members and countless friends.
